Best time to go to Sommatino

The best time to visit Sommatino can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Sommatino falls in July, when visitor numbers are high and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ature in Sommatino falls in January, visitor numbers are low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January45.3°F (7.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owSlightly Low
February45.9°F (7.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March48.9°F (9.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
April55.0°F (12.8°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May63.5°F (17.5°C)No RainSunnyLowAverage
June74.1°F (23.4°C)No RainSunnyHighAverage
July80.4°F (26.9°C)No RainSunnyHighSlightly High
August79.9°F (26.6°C)No RainSunnyHighSlightly High
September72.3°F (22.4°C)Light R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
October64.2°F (17.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December48.4°F (9.1°C)No RainMostly SunnyLow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Sommatino

To reach Sommatino, Sicily, you can fly into three major airports. Catania (CTA-Fontanarossa) is 95.0km away, with nearby hotels like the 5-star Romano Palace Luxury Hotel and the 4-star Palace Catania | UNA Esperienze. Palermo (PMO-Punta Raisi) is 123.9km distant, offering options such as the 4-star Saracen Sands Hotel & Congress Centre and the Magaggiari Hotel Resort. Trapani (TPS-Vicenzo Florio) is 148.1km from Sommatino, featuring the luxurious Baglio Oneto dei Principi di San Lorenzo. When is the best time to go to Sommatino?
The best time to go to Sommatino is during the spring (April to June) and autumn (September to October) months.These periods offer pleasant weather, with warm but not excessively hot temperatures, making it ideal for exploring the town and the surrounding Sicilian countryside. You'll find fewer crowds compared to the peak summer season, allowing for a more relaxed experience.Couples looking for a romantic getaway will appreciate the mild evenings great for al fresco dining and leisurely strolls through the town's historic centre. The spring brings blooming wildflowers, adding a picturesque backdrop to your visit, while autumn offers the opportunity to experience local harvest festivals.For travellers interested in cultural exploration and outdoor activities like hiking or visiting archaeological sites, these shoulder seasons provide comfortable conditions.
